Transaction 53160578b079e33633ccc951eef9b4efa9358a9a15ceb51247d322688d9b57b8
1 Input
1 Output
-
53160578b079e33633ccc951eef9b4efa9358a9a15ceb51247d322688d9b57b8:0
- value
- 4404324
- script pubkey
- OP_0 OP_PUSHBYTES_20 216d2ca69cd1fd805d47220064ae7452aa3f4bae
- address
- bc1qy9kjef5u687cqh28ygqxftn5224r7jawrhsejh